The meaning of this song comes from the Ancient Slavic traditions, basically SHUM is a name of a forest God, in ancient traditions, women were singing these kind of Mantras to wake this God up with the coming of Spring after his long Winter slumber.

U savremenom ukrajinskom reč "šum" znači "buka", ali osim toga u ukrajinskoj mitologiji postoji biće, koje se isto zove Šum. Istraživači misle da ime ovog bića i južnoslovenska reč "šuma" (u savremenom ukrajinskom umesto "šuma" koristi se reč "lis") imaju zajednički koren, jer je ovaj Šum u ukrajinskoj mitologiji - duh šume. U ovoj pesmi se radi o ovom duhu
